Once the truffles are consumed, their spores are distribute across the forest due to the fact they cannot disperse on their own.

Geopora spp. are crucial ectomycorrhizal partners of trees in woodlands and forests through the entire globe.[1] Pinus edulis, a popular pine species in the Southwest US, is dependent on Geopora for nutrient and h2o acquisition in arid environments.

Best Pairings McKinney and Chang both of those recommend using a microplane or truffle shaver to launch the flavor of raw truffles more than warm dishes. Oddly, truffles have hardly any flavor if eaten raw and cold.

First, they have got symbiotic interactions with specific varieties of trees and improve close to their roots. This is referred to as mycorrhizae. Truffles also will need cool winters and moist springs accompanied by sizzling summers with moderate rain. They expand slowly and gradually (it might take 6 to 7 many years to obtain a harvest) and also have a short period.

Weather: Truffles have to have moderate seasonal temperatures, and they have a tendency to expand in regions with heat summers get more info and funky winters. Rainfall needs to be enough although not extreme, as extremely damp or dry situations can halt their enhancement.

How would you Cook dinner with truffles? Typically, truffles are thinly shaved on top of a cooked food but when you grate them on the Microplane alternatively, the high-quality shavings integrate far better Together with the dish.

When the Puppy suggests that a truffle is close by, truffle hunters use a specialized spade to extract the truffles with none considerable disturbance to your soil and its surrounding ecosystem. While this regular approach continues to be helpful in finding truffles, employing animals continue to has its limitations with regard to scale and effectiveness. A short while ago, contemporary technological innovation has long been incorporated into truffle hunting for even better outcomes.

Truffle Pigs: Historically, pigs had been used in truffle hunting due to their all-natural affinity for truffles. However, their inclination to take in the truffles they obtain and The issue in running them in the sphere have built dogs the greater preferred preference.
